| Build Volume | 150 x 150 x 150 mm |
|---|---|
| Filament Diameter | 1.75 mm |
| Nozzle Diameter | 0.4 mm |
| Extruder Type | Single |
| Print Speed | Up to 150 mm/s |
| Connectivity | USB, Wi-Fi |
| Supported Materials | PLA |
| Operating Temperature | 15 - 30°C |
